    Miles and Snow have produced a typology of business-level strategies. As opposed to corporate-level strategy‚ i.e.‚decisions related to what businesses should the firm be in‚ business-level strategy is related to how the organization competes in a given business (Hambrick‚ 1983). Miles and Snow proposed that firms in general develop relatively stable patterns of strategic behaviour in order to accomplish a good alignment with the perceived environmental conditions.     Test-driven development cycle A graphical representation of the development cycle‚ using a basic flowchart The following sequence is based on the book Test-Driven Development by Example.[1] 1. Add a test In test-driven development‚ each new feature begins with writing a test. This test must inevitably fail because it is written before the feature has been implemented.
